Web20 feb. 2015 · Music, Arts and Literature Filipinos are very fond of music. They use various materials to create sound. They love performing dances (Tiniking and Carinosa) and group singing during festive celebrations. Settlers from Spain introduced to them a variety of musical instruments like the ukulele, trumpet, drums and violin. Web26 jul. 2016 · Doctrina cristiana (Christian doctrine) was the first book printed in the Philippines 1593. It was printed using the process called xylography imported from Spain. It was written by Fr. Juan de Placencia and Fr. Domingo Nieva, written both in …
